Terrible idea to drink when underage at work. As someone else said - HR will find out, you won’t get a return offer, etc. Let your team know you’re under 21 and they will understand.
You can get water or a seltzer at a happy hour to blend in
Was in same boat - don’t drink at company events or anytime VP and up is present, but they shouldn’t have any sponsored events where you need to be 21+ to attend. If you have a fake and juniors are telling you it’s fine to drink when it’s just them, that’s probably fine but try to do it on weekends only. Default to not drinking if you’re unsure.

I don't think the risk of possibly not getting a return offer by being a liability (company is associated with underage drinking) is worth the gain of... what? Fitting in better? No one is going to give you crap for being underage- that's an understandable reason why you wouldn't be 'socializing' with other bankers after work. Yeah it'll suck a bit by not having the opportunity to go out with the other dudes at your work but I don't think its worth at all what you are risking.
No reason to lie about your age. Just get a seltzer or anything without alcohol. It’s a good skill to be able to socialize sober. I occasionally go out sober and still enjoy it.
